Owen's Chase
By David Taylor (II)
Owen's Chase is an asymmetrical 2-player deduction game set in the 19th century Nantucket. Whales are trying to safely travel north to the feeding grounds to feast on rich krill while being pursued by a sharp lookout in the crow's nest of a whaling ship. On each expedition, use your senses to track down a whale in the vast ocean. But be careful of dangerous weather, unexpected repairs, or even a nasty tail fluke that can bring your chase quickly to an end. One player plays as the Whale and the other as the Lookout. The Whale player puts the cards face down in a 4 x 4 grid, and the Lookout chooses cards. Based on the card chosen when revealed, various actions occur that can have the Lookout win, the Whale win, or other results. Play continues until the Whale is found or or the Shipyard is found, or until the expedition ends. Cards include the Whale, a tail attack, crow's nest, open ocean, shipyard, and storm. —user summary
